Git - Process Steps

Import Version

Import new Version from Git

NameTypeDescriptionRequired
Repository URLtextBoxThe location of the Git repository, such as https://git.example.com/myproject.git.Yes
BranchtextBoxGit branch that contains the artifacts you want to retrieve. Default is masterNo
UsernametextBoxOptional username to specify for authenticating with the Git repository using the http(s) protocol.No
PasswordsecureBoxOptional password to specify for authenticating with the Git repository using the http(s) protocol.No
Watch for TagscheckBoxWhen selected, tags are used as the basis for new component versions.No
RecursivecheckBoxWhen selected, all submodules within the project are initialized using their default settings.No
Disable SSL VerificationcheckBoxCheck this box to disable SSL certificate verification. This option will allow invalid SSL certificates.No
SparsecheckBoxCheck this box if you want to use the sparse clone feature of git and Specify the path accordingly in the Path to Sparse box.No
Sparse PathstextBoxSpecify the path of the directories in the base git repository to clone specifically. Separate each path with new lines or commas: MY/DIR1,SUB/DIR2. This is only checked if configured for sparse mode.No
IncludestextAreaBoxThe file name patterns used to match files for inclusion. The wildcard ** indicates every directory, and the wildcard * indicates every file. The pattern dist/**/*, for example, retrieves the entire file tree beneath the dist directory. Separate each pattern with new lines or commas.No
ExcludestextAreaBoxThe file name patterns used to match files for exclusion. The wildcard ** indicates every directory, and the wildcard * indicates every file. Separate each pattern with new lines or commas.No
GIT PathtextBoxThe path to the Git executable file on the server. If you have added the Git executable to the system PATH variable, you can simply specify the name of the executable, such as git. If you have not added the Git executable to the system PATH variable, specify the complete path to the Git executable.Yes
Preserve Execute PermissionscheckBoxFor Linux and UNIX operating systems, select this check box to retain the execute permissions for each file.No
Extensions of files to ConverttextBoxIf text-type files must be converted into another character set, type the list of file extensions to be converted. Matching file types are converted into the default character set of the system where the agent is located. Separate list items with commas.No
